Should you play it?

Play the classic board game, Axis & Allies 1942 2nd Edition! Act as WWII powers in a turn-based strategy game that fits your screen and schedule— get notified on your turn and command armies at your own pace! Team up with friends, challenge the world’s top players, or go solo vs. A.I.

What works

  • Faithful adaptation of classic board game
  • Robust online multiplayer with ranked matchmaking
  • Asynchronous turn-based play fits busy schedules
  • Deep strategic and tactical gameplay
  • Active developer support and community

Things to keep in mind

  • Ai is weak and predictable
  • Lack of chat limits social interaction
  • Limited customization and no mod support
  • Some ui clunkiness and minor bugs
  • No alternate maps or scenarios included
